It has been an extremely challenging year for the world and this festive season is likely to be different for many of us owing to the ongoing restrictions and measures in place across several countries and territories.

Motorsport was not exempt from the pandemic, and suffered a hiatus of several months, but worked tirelessly to get championships up and running in vastly altered circumstances.

The majority of events were held behind closed doors, lacking fans and atmosphere, but championships were able to keep going by taking vital precautions and applying protocols.

Formula 1 crowned Lewis Hamilton and Mercedes champions for a seventh time, MotoGP anointed a new title-winner in Suzuki rider Joan Mir, while Toyota swept up in the World Endurance Championship.

Scott Dixon made it six in IndyCar, with Takuma Sato a double-winner at the 500, while Sebastien Ogier took back his WRC crown to become a seven-time champion.

Mick Schumacher and Oscar Piastri won titles in Formula 2 and Formula 3, Antonio Felix da Costa and Techeetah were crowned Formula E kings, with Rene Rast three-peating in DTM.
